当前位置:首页  资讯

资讯

pattern是什么意思啊(pattern是什么意思)

2024-09-22 17:30:39
导读 大家好,小东方来为大家解答以上的问题。pattern是什么意思啊,pattern是什么意思这个很多人还不知道,现在让我们一起来看看吧!1、java 中p...

大家好,小东方来为大家解答以上的问题。pattern是什么意思啊,pattern是什么意思这个很多人还不知道,现在让我们一起来看看吧!

1、java 中pattern为正则表达式的编译表示形式。

2、指定为字符串的正则表达式必须首先被编译为此类的实例。

3、然后,可将得到的模式用于创建 Matcher 对象,依照正则表达式,该对象可以与任意字符序列匹配。

4、执行匹配所涉及的所有状态都驻留在匹配器中,所以多个匹配器可以共享同一模式。

5、例子如下:Pattern p = Pattern.compile("a*b");Matcher m = p.matcher("aaaaab");boolean b = m.matches();在仅使用一次正则表达式时,可以方便地通过此类定义 matches 方法。

6、此方法编译表达式并在单个调用中将输入序列与其匹配。

7、语句boolean b = Pattern.matches("a*b", "aaaaab");。

本文到此分享完毕,希望对大家有所帮助。

免责声明:本文由用户上传,如有侵权请联系删除!